2. How to obtain the BAA
Active customers receive the BAA as part of standard onboarding documentation, executed before any PHI exchange. Prospects evaluating Medonix can request the BAA in advance for review by their privacy or compliance counsel.
To request a copy:
- Email [email protected] with the subject line "BAA request."
- Reference your organization name and the legal entity that will execute the agreement.
- Indicate whether you require a redline draft or are evaluating the standard form.
Most BAA requests are turned around within one business day. Customer-specific redlines (e.g., breach-notification window, reporting cadence, indemnification scope) are negotiated during onboarding and routed through our legal team.
3. Subcontractor BAAs
Medonix maintains executed BAAs with every subcontractor that creates, receives, maintains, or transmits PHI on our behalf. The full subcontractor list is available to customers under NDA on request.
